I configured a PC with linuxcnc 2.5.0, a mesa 5i25 with prob_rfx2 
firmware (directly compatible with most DB25 parallel port stepper 
drivers) a while ago, following the indications and 5i25 xml file for 
pncconf in this thread
http://comments.gmane.org/gmane.linux.distributions.emc.user/33631


This worked great and I had a functioning machine.
Now, I changed PC and reinstalled from scratch linuxcnc, updated to 
2.5.3, then tried Pncconf again. This time it outputs an error when 
moving to the next screen after selecting the 5i25 board:


PNCconf encountered an error.  The following information may be useful 
in troubleshooting:

Traceback (most recent call last):
   File "/usr/bin/pncconf", line 5282, in on_mesa_boardname_changed
     if  "7i43" in d[_BOARDNAME] :
UnboundLocalError: local variable 'd' referenced before assignment



I followed exactly the same procedure, so it seems pncconf wants 
something more to integrate a new card/firmware...
Since this worked in 2.5.0, and not anymore, it is a regression; which 
is why I am posting this in the developer forum.
Fortunately, I had a backup of my .ini and .hal config for 2.5.0, so I 
am not stuck. But I think this should be looked at by the pncconf developer.
